I love my Canon Selphy printer for printing great 4×6 photos for my scrapbook layouts. There are a few ways to connect to the device. Let me show you how.

Many Ways to Connect
I often print directly from my computer and send photos to the Canon Selphy CP1300 printer just like my large HP 8.5×11 printer. In this case, I turn on the device and have the little printer connect to my home WIFI. But using your phone takes a non-intuitive way to connect. You can also simply insert your memory card into the slot near the paper tray opening in front of the printer. If all else fails, use this method!
Setup the Printer
- Turn on the printer
- Load ink, if necessary
- Load paper tray with 4×6 Canon paper
- Press the “WIFI” button on the top of the printer
- Select Direct Connection, see screenshots below
Note: If it does not have the option to Direct Connect, then turn off the printer and restart it
From the Phone
- Install Canon Selphy App
- Install Selphy Photo Layout App
- Disconnect from any current WIFI connection
- Now on WIFI, select the CP1300 printer with your printer’s name

Using the Selphy Phone App
Now you should be ready to print! Open the Canon PRINT app. This should automatically connect to your Canon Selphy if it is turned on. Use “Photo Print” option to select your photos to print.




If you want to create a collage, then use the option “SELPHY Photo Layout”. This is an additional download. The app is called “SELPHY Photo Layout. Download, then use it from the Canon Selphy app.
